Why Are Tiles in Swimming Pool So Important?
The significance of tiles in swimming pool extends beyond aesthetics. They serve as the core surface that contacts water continuously, demanding resilience against constant moisture, chemical exposure, and physical wear. Here are some pivotal reasons why quality pool tiles matter:
- Durability: Pool tiles must withstand the harsh effects of chlorinated water, UV rays, and temperature fluctuations without deteriorating.
- Safety: Properly installed tiles with non-slip surfaces prevent accidents and injuries around the pool deck and interior.
- Maintenance: Well-chosen tiles are easier to clean, resist mold and algae, and retain their aesthetic appeal over time.
- Aesthetic Appeal: Tiles contribute to the overall design, color scheme, and visual harmony of the pool area, adding value and beauty.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Long-lasting, high-quality tiles reduce the need for frequent repairs and replacements, ensuring economic efficiency.
Types of Pool Tiles: Finding the Perfect Match for Your Pool
Choosing the right type of tiles in swimming pool is crucial to achieve your desired look and performance. Here, we delve into the most popular types of pool tiles, their characteristics, and suitable applications.
Ceramic and Porcelain Pool Tiles
Ceramic and porcelain tiles are among the most common choices for pool interiors due to their affordability, wide range of designs, and water-resistant properties. Porcelain tiles, in particular, are denser and less porous, offering superior resistance against chemicals and stains.
Glass Pool Tiles
For a stunning, luxurious look, glass pool tiles provide vibrant color options, reflective surfaces, and a sleek finish. They are highly resistant to UV rays and algae growth, but require professional installation and careful maintenance.
Stone Tiles
Natural stones such as travertine, slate, or pebble aggregate create a textured, organic aesthetic. These tiles are incredibly durable and slip-resistant but need proper sealing to prevent water absorption and staining.
Vinyl and Rubber Pool Tiles
Primarily used for pool decks or steps, these materials offer excellent shock absorption and slip resistance. They are easy to install and maintain but less common for the pool interior surface.
Design Considerations for Selecting Tiles in Swimming Pool
Beyond choosing the type of tile, several design factors influence your ultimate decision. These considerations ensure your pool’s functionality and aesthetic are perfectly aligned with your lifestyle and environment.
Color and Pattern Selection
The color of the pool tiles can significantly affect the overall ambiance. Light-colored tiles tend to create a bright, open feel, making the pool appear larger, while darker tiles lend a more intimate, sophisticated atmosphere. Patterns and mosaics can add intricate detail or modern minimalism to your design.
Textural Variations
Opt for tiles with non-slip textures in areas prone to moisture and foot traffic to enhance safety. Textured tiles also add depth and visual identity to the pool interior.
Size and Shape
Small mosaic tiles can produce a dynamic visual effect and hide minor imperfections, while larger tiles streamline the appearance for sleek, contemporary pools. The shape—square, rectangular, hexagonal—also impacts the overall design flow.

Maintenance and Care of Your Pool Tiles
Maintaining your tiles in swimming pool is essential for longevity and visual appeal. Regular cleaning, proper chemical balancing, and routine inspections are the pillars of pool tile maintenance.
Cleaning Tips
- Use a soft-bristled brush and non-abrasive cleanser to scrub tiles periodically.
- Remove stubborn stains or algae with specialized pool tile cleaners.
- Check and clean grout lines to prevent mold buildup.
Preventive Measures
- Maintain proper chlorine and pH levels to minimize corrosion.
- Apply sealants periodically to high-traffic or porous tiles.
- Inspect tiles regularly for cracks or damage and schedule repairs promptly.
